Application library

While iPhones have had a feature called App Library before, it only comes to iPads with the iPadOS 15 operating system. If you would like, for example, newly downloaded apps on your iPad to be automatically saved to the App Library and not take up space on your desktop, head to Settings -> Desktop and Dock, where you activate the item Keep only in the application library.

Adding widgets to the desktop

Like iOS, the iPadOS operating system now also offers the option of adding widgets to the desktop of your Apple tablet. The procedure is the same as on the iPhone, that is long press the iPad home screen, ownerin the upper corner tap on + and select the desired widget from the list. Then just tap on the blue button Add a widget.

Quick notes

If you often work with native Notes on your iPad, you'll certainly welcome a feature called Quick Note. Apple Pencil owners have the option to activate a quick note by swiping the tip of the Apple Pencil from the bottom right corner towards the center of the screen. others can add this option to Control Center v Settings -> Control Center, where you just need to add the required element.

Even better Safari

The Safari web browser also underwent significant changes in the iPadOS 15 operating system. It will now offer, for example, the possibility of playing content from the YouTube website in 4K resolution. In addition, you can also use the option to quickly switch to reader mode here - just hold for a long time three dots at the top of the display. The procedure for closing all open cards at once, when it is enough, has also been accelerated long hold the currently opened card and then tap on in the menu Close other panels.

Application activity log

As part of an even better protection of the privacy of its users, Apple has also introduced in iPadOS 15 the ability to record the activity of applications, so that you can more easily find out which applications have used access to your data. Run to activate this recordingSettings -> Privacy, at the very bottom tap on Record app activity and activate the corresponding item.
